Summary: | dev-haskell/hit aborts install on not finding various dependencies even though they're installed |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Jappie Klooster <jappieklooster> |
Component: | Current packages | Assignee: | Gentoo's Haskell Language team <haskell> |
Status: | RESOLVED FIXED | ||
Severity: | normal | Keywords: | PMASKED |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Jappie Klooster
2017-11-12 21:27:04 UTC
(In reply to Jappie Klooster from comment #0) > * environment, line 657: Called cabal-die-if-nonempty 'broken' > 'conduit-1.2.8' 'QuickCheck-2.9.2' 'http-client-tls-0.3.3' 'pandoc-1.19.2.1' > 'x509-system-1.5.0' 'doctemplates-0.1.0.2' 'skylighting-0.3' > 'http-types-0.8.6' 'x509-validation-1.5.2' 'http-client-0.5.7.0' > 'crypto-numbers-0.2.7' 'aeson-1.0.2.1' 'temporary-1.2.0.4' > 'crypto-random-0.0.9' 'crypto-pubkey-0.2.8' 'gtk2hs-buildtools-0.13.2.2' > 'resourcet-1.1.7.4' 'connection-0.2.4' 'enclosed-exceptions-1.0.1.1' > 'tls-1.2.18' 'scientific-0.3.4.9' 'yaml-0.8.10.1' 'attoparsec-0.13.0.1' > 'pandoc-types-1.17.0.4' 'texmath-0.9.1' > * environment, line 587: Called die > * The specific snippet of code: > * die "//==-- Please, run 'haskell-updater' to fix ${breakage_type} > packages --==//" The output suggests a few haskell depends were broken (presumably by a dependency upgrade). If you run haskell-updater, does it fix the issue? The bug has been referenced in the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=6c5ca5dec763541eb3748c5f3c3bd8657479257c commit 6c5ca5dec763541eb3748c5f3c3bd8657479257c Author: Sam James <sam@gentoo.org> AuthorDate: 2022-07-22 22:53:40 +0000 Commit: Sam James <sam@gentoo.org> CommitDate: 2022-07-22 22:57:24 +0000 profiles: last-rite broken, revdep-less Haskell packages As discussed in #gentoo-haskell. More items are likely to be added to this mask, like we've done with Python packages in the past. Bug: https://bugs.gentoo.org/830336 Bug: https://bugs.gentoo.org/637278 Bug: https://bugs.gentoo.org/652014 Signed-off-by: Sam James <sam@gentoo.org> profiles/package.mask | 13 +++++++++++++ 1 file changed, 13 insertions(+) The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=97baad1da8842d35360d68754d6b0bdf34b7a8ff commit 97baad1da8842d35360d68754d6b0bdf34b7a8ff Author: Jakov Smolić <jsmolic@gentoo.org> AuthorDate: 2022-08-22 07:17:38 +0000 Commit: Jakov Smolić <jsmolic@gentoo.org> CommitDate: 2022-08-22 07:17:38 +0000 dev-haskell/hit: treeclean Closes: https://bugs.gentoo.org/637278 Signed-off-by: Jakov Smolić <jsmolic@gentoo.org> dev-haskell/hit/Manifest | 1 - dev-haskell/hit/hit-0.7.0.ebuild | 33 --------------------------------- dev-haskell/hit/metadata.xml | 17 ----------------- profiles/package.mask | 1 - 4 files changed, 52 deletions(-) |